Is vagina swelling/redness/soreness normal after first time sex?!?!

Seriously.. I'm worried.  I've never had sex before, but it's really swollen and red... and bleeding a little bit.  It feels like it almost got ripped a little bit or something.. we had it only about 20 minutes ago, no lube, condom, but I get pretty wet.. so that's okay?  Use lube next time?  He also went a little rough, so does it sound normal?  Will it go away in a few days?  Any answers would be LOVED.  Please help guys, I'm nervous.

You might be allergic to the condom.  What was it made of?  The other option is that it was your first time, and maybe it is normal.  Try a sitzbath or rest on a package of frozen peas wrapped in a towel, and see if the swelling calms down.
